Impact of COVID-19 on Help-Seeking Behavior by Rural Survivors of IPV

Abstract

This article interrogates the effects of COVID-19 in a rural community by triangulating data from law enforcement and a center for victims of crime with interviews of the social services providers. This project uses a longitudinal approach to examine trends of survivors of intimate partner violence reaching out for help from law enforcement and social services providers, as well as qualitative data from interviews with social services providers.
